Recently I bought this set from victrix despite not being able to see too much of it online. I could not find any other pictures of these figures besides the ONE offered by victrix. I hope these help others decide if they are interested in it. The pack of 8 is 12 pounds. They paint up rather nicely and are more detailed than their officers in the box set. The standard bearers hands need to be attached with and not plastic cement since they are resin. They are shipped all together in a thin plastic box, and one of the fanion spear heads tip broke off in transport. Otherwise they were all good.
Here is one I painted to add to my 71st HLI regiment.

Not to be pedantic, but I'm going to be pedantic…

Your 71 HLI officer isn't quite right. As Highlanders, the officers wore their sash over the shoulder instead of around the waist.

Not that anyone makes an appropriate figure for this, which is why I'm tearing my hair out. You've made a decent run at it, given what's available, but I for one really wish someone (Perry, Front Rank) would make proper HLI command figures.

codonnell21808 Sep 2014 3:30 p.m. PST

@mserafin

I am aware. I used victrix highland officers with the sash and trouser and gave them a shako for my other officers. For my Sargent I cut a highland torso from the kilt and glued it to a pair of trouser legs to give him the shoulder sash as well.
